Craycroft Elementary School

Serving 586 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Craycroft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Arizona for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 11% (which is lower than the Arizona state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 24% (which is lower than the Arizona state average of 40%).
The student-teacher ratio of 22:1 is higher than the Arizona state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 92%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Arizona state average of 67% (majority Hispanic).

My son has attended this school since kindergarten. During the COVID-19 pandemic, these teachers worked hard to provide him with a complete learning experience that included math, reading, science, art, PE, music, and more. He LOVES his school, and he feels safe. There are plenty of extended learning opportunities for families who seek them - 8% of the students in the district participate in the gifted program. Like all Arizona schools, Craycroft suffers from a lack of resources and support at the state level; but Sunnyside is an amazing district with a close-knit community. Supportive families with the resources and commitment to work with teachers as instructional partners will find many opportunities for students to learn and grow. My student has been encouraged to develop his identity as a learner, and his teachers recognize and support his interests and abilities. We have found the school leadership to be accessible and attentive, and teachers communicate regularly through ClassDojo, phone, and email. We are regularly made aware of our son's academic progress, and we are confident that he has been properly prepared for future levels of learning. The elementary school is right next door to the middle school, so we expect the transition to be made much easier. Through the 21st Century Community Learning Center program, my son has participated in literacy and math enrichment through gardening, technology, and sports, and there are many other similar opportunities. The teachers here care about my student, and they are committed to helping him grow; there are no test scores that will ever reflect that.
